Avalanche handling on the bts road section. Maros City – bts. Kab. Bone needs to review the value of the safe factor of the handling method applied.  This study aims to quantitatively examine the influence of geotextiles and retaining walls on the magnitude of the value of the safe factor on a slope.  This analysis uses data from the results of avalanche handling work on KM.89+995-90+045 and KM.90+395-90+405. In this study, 2 methods were used, namely the Fellenius method and the Plaxis program method. The results of this study show that the amount of safe factor values from the handling methods used at KM.89+995-90+045 and KM.90+395-90+405 locations is 2.71 and 2.27 obtained from the results of data processing using the Plaxis program, while using the Fellenius method the safe factor values are 2.70 and 1.66. Thus each safe factor value obtained is greater than the established safe factor value ( Fs > 1.5).
